Output 80b86a56139885febce7c8005fe2d136ffbdd1c2db66fec58e2ecc6ef09098bf:1

value
684933
script pubkey
OP_0 OP_PUSHBYTES_20 5ad11311387eeef274179e7ecf7ac432e2822d44
address
bc1qttg3xyfc0mh0yaqhnelv77kyxt3gyt2y9q5nqx
transaction
80b86a56139885febce7c8005fe2d136ffbdd1c2db66fec58e2ecc6ef09098bf
confirmations
4009
spent
false